Output 128cf98ea67620e77d3e4281694f7d555042a7145e1d18a809e8d75b7aa3fb7f:76

value
116908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c89fd5bb33eb39162c05c4943727d611250ecf8 OP_EQUAL
address
35kWxg8DaYJmcLMD8u9PXvG5VxFPKgg3bY
transaction
128cf98ea67620e77d3e4281694f7d555042a7145e1d18a809e8d75b7aa3fb7f
confirmations
167423
spent
true